Vous êtes sur la page 1sur 39

STANDARDS DE

MULTIPLEXAGE
Pr. J. EL ABBADI
ECOLE MOHAMMADIA DINGENIEURS
DEPT GENIE ELECTRIQUE
Email: elabbadi@emi.ac.ma

Partie 3

MULTIPLEXAGE A
REPARTITION DE CODES
CODE DIVISION MULTIPLE ACCESS
CDMA

MODULATION NUMERIQUE

Modulation damplitude ASK

Modulation de frquence FSK

Les donnes numriques modulent lamplitude du


signal porteur
Les donnes numriques modulent la frquence
du signal porteur

Modulation de phase PSK

Les donnes numriques modulent la phase du


signal porteur

Modulation damplitude ASK


d(t)

Modulation de frquence FSK


1 modul par une frquence fm
0 modul par une frquence fs
1

Modulation de Phase PSK


Modulation BPSK
1 modul par une Phase 1

2=

1=0

0 modul par une Phase 2

Modulation QPSK
Chaque groupement de deux bits
est modul par une phase i
i=0;1;2 ou 3

(1;0)
1=3/4

(0;0)
0=/4

2=5/4
(1;1)

3=7/4
(0;1)

Spectre du signal BPSK


1.2

0.8

0.6

0.4

0.2

-1/Tb

1/Tb

Modulation de Phase Multi niveaux

Chaque combinaison de bits correspond


une amplitude et une phase bien dtermine
de la porteuse

Systme Large Bande

Un signal est dit bande troite si sa largeur


de bande est trs infrieure la frquence
porteuse (ou frquence centrale); dans le cas
contraire il est signal large bande.
Un systme est dit bande troite si la
largeur du signal mis en jeu est infrieure la
bande de cohrence du systme; dans le cas
contraire le systme est dit large bande.

Etalement de spectre

Lopration dtalement consiste


transformer un signal bande troite en un
signal large bande comparable au bruit.

Largeur de bande trs importante


Densit spectrale de puissance trs faible

Caractristiques

Accs multiple rpartition de codes AMRC


CDMA Code division Multiple Access
Faible Brouillage aux autres missions
Rjection des interfrences
Limitation des effets causs par la
propagation trajets multiples

Spectre et Gain de traitement


Ps
Etalement de spectre

Pss
Bss

Bs
Largeur de bande Bs
Densit spectrale de puissance Ps

Largeur de bande Bss


Densit spectrale de puissance Pss

Gain de traitement

G=

Bss Ps
=
Bs Pss

Mthodes usuelles dtalement de spectre

Mthode dtalement squence directe


Direct Sequence DS

Mthode dtalement saut de frquences


Frequency Hopping

Mthode dtalement saut temporel


Time Hopping

Etalement de spectre squence directe

Modulation de base bande troite PSK


Schma du modulateur
d(t)
donnes

Horloge
CLKC

Mlange

Gnrateur
Pseudo alatoire

Modulation PSK

s(t)

Tb dure dun bit de donnes


Tc dure dun bit du gnrateur
Tc << Tb

Etalement de spectre squence directe


Sans mlange
Avec le signal
pseudo alatoire

Avec mlange
Avec le signal
pseudo alatoire

1.2

1,2

0.8

0,8

0.6

0,6

0.4

0,4

0.2

0,2

fc-1/Tb

fc fc+1/Tb

fc-1/Tc

Largeur de bande
Bs=2/Tb

fc

fc+1/Tc

Largeur de bande
Bss=2/Tc

Gain de traitement G = Bss/Bs = Tb/Tc

Etalement de spectre squence directe


Schma du dmodulateur
s(t)
DEModulation
PSK

Mlange

Estimation
De donnes
d(t)

Regnration
Dhorloge

Synchronisation

Gnrateur
Pseudo alatoire

Les deux Gnrateurs PA cot TX et RX sont


identiques

Etalement de spectre saut de frquence

Modulation de base bande troite FSK


Schma du modulateur

donnes

d(t)

Modulation FSK

Mlange

s(t)

Synthtiseur
de frquences

Horloge
CLKC

Gnrateur
Pseudo alatoire

Etalement de spectre saut de frquence

Schma du dmodulateur
s(t)

Donnes
Modulation FSK

Mlange

d(t)
estimes

Regnration
Dhorloge

Synchronisation

Synthtiseur
de frquences

Gnrateur
Pseudo alatoire

Les deux Gnrateurs PA cot TX et RX sont


identiques

Etalement de spectre saut de frquences

Dfinitions

Tb : dure dun bit de donnes


Ts : dure dun symbole de la modulation FSK
Tc : dure dun bit du gnrateur pseudo alatoire

Ts= K . Tb

K nombre de bits par symbole

Etalement de spectre saut de frquence

Nombre de frquences du modulateur FSK

Nombre de frquences du synthtiseur

Ns=2K k nombre de bits par symbole de donnes

Nc=2n n nombre de chips par symbole du


gnrateur pseudoalatoire

Saut de frquences lent


Ts < Tc

Une frquence du synthtiseur dure plus longtemps quun


symbole de donnes
Une frquence du synthtiseur module plusieurs symboles
de donnes

Exemple cas Tc=2Ts

Squence de bits [ 1 0 1 1 0 1 0 0 1 0]
Modulation FSK 4 niveaux (frquence f0, f1, f2 et f3)
Synthtiseur de frquences 4 frquences de sorties w0,
w1, w2, w3

Evolution du spectre en fonction du temps


0

Tb
Ts
f3
f2
f1
f0
t

w2

w1

w0
Tc

Tc

Tc

Saut de frquences rapide

Ts > Tc

Exemple cas Ts=2Tc

Le synthtiseur change de frquence plusieurs fois


pendant la priode dun symbole de donnes
Une frquence du synthtiseur module en partie les
symboles de donnes

Squence de bits [ 1 0 1 1 0 1 0 0 1 0]
Modulation FSK 4 niveaux (frquence f0, f1, f2 et f3)
Synthtiseur de frquences 4 frquences de sorties w0,
w1, w2, w3

Evolution du spectre en fonction du temps


0

Tb
Ts
f3
f2
f1
f0
t

w2

w1

w0
Tc

Tc

Tc

Principe de la CDMA

Chaque utilisateur utilise son propre code


Les codes ont la mme priode (nombre de
bits), mme frquence dhorloge.
Les utilisateurs partages le mme spectre
radio frquence.
Chaque utilisateur restitue ses donnes en
utilisant le mme code.

Dmodulation par un code diffrent


1

=0

=0

=0

=0

=0

d
c1
d*c1
c2

d*c1*c2

d*c1*c2

=0

=0

=0

=0

=0

Codes orthogonaux

Un signal dmodul par un autre codes c2


diffrent de celui utilis lors de ltalement de
spectre c1 doit produire un signal nul la sortie.
Les codes c1 et c2 sont alors orthogonaux
c--d
c1*c2=0
Le produit * dsigne le produit de corrlation de c1 et c2

Construire un systme CDMA revient chercher


un ensemble de codes orthogonaux deux
deux

Squences longueur maximale

Les squences longueur maximale sont


gnrs par des registres dcalage
raction linaire
Forme canonique

g1

g2

gm-1

g3
3

m-1

Sortie

Squences longueur maximale

g0, g1..gm-1 sont les coefficients du polynme


gnrateur de la squence
g(D)=g0+g1D+g2D2+..+gm-1Dm-1+Dm

Exemple 1

Exemple 2

g(D)=1+D+D3

g(D)=1+D+D2+D3

Squences longueur maximale

Exemple 1

Exemple 2
1

Etat initial

Cycle de la squence

Cycle de la squence

Squences longueur maximale

Exemple 1
Squence gnre
[1011100]

Exemple 2
Squence gnre
[1100]

Longueur de la squence
N= 7 chips = 23-1

Longueur de la sequence
N=4 chips < 23-1

La longueur est maximale

La longueur est non


maximale

Squences longueur maximale

Une condition ncessaire et suffisante pour que g(D) gnre une


squence longueur maximale est que g(D) soit primitif et
irrductible dans le champ de Galois G(2m)
Longueur = 2m-1
Nombre de bits 1 = 2(m-1)
Nombre de bits 0 = 2(m-1) + 1
Le nombre total N, de squences longueur maximale obtenues
partir d'un registre dcalage m cellules est donn par :

2m 1
Ns =
m

o (n) est le nombre d'Euler (Nombre d'entiers infrieurs n et


premier avec n)

Tableau de valeurs de Ns:


m

L=2m-1

Ns

15

31

63

127

18

255

16

511

48

10

1023

60

11

2047

176

12

4095

144

Fonction d'autocorrelation

L=2m-1
La fonction d'autocorrelation discrte est
donne par :
1.0
R(kTc ) = 1
- L
1

-1/L
LTc

si k = iLTc
si k iLTc

Fonction d'intercorrelation

La fonction d'intercorrelation discrte entre deux


squences de longueur maximale c1 et c2 est
donne par:
1 L 1
Fc1c2 (kTc ) = c1 (iTc )c2 ((i + k )Tc )
L i =0

Lanalyse des valeurs de pics des fonctions


dintercorrelation donnes par le tableau de la page
suivante montre que les squences longueur
maximale sont mal adapts aux systmes CDMA

Pics d'intercorrelation des squences


longueur maximale

L=2m-1

Pic

0.71

15

0.60

31

0.36

63

0.35

127

0.32

255

0.37

511

0.22

10

1023

0.37

11

2047

0.14

12

4095

0.34

Les codes de GoId

Ces codes sont utiliss pour leur capacit gnrer un grand


nombre de codes partir de deux registres dcalage et leur
bonne proprits de corrlation.
Gold montrer l'existence de paires de squences longueur
maximal dont la fonction d'intercorrelation prend uniquement trois
valeurs distinctes.
ces paires de squences sont dites privilgies dont la fonction
d'intercorrelation prend l'une des trois valeurs (-1, -t(m), t(m)-2}
avec

2(m+1)/ 2 + 1 m impair
t (m ) = (m + 2 )/ 2
m pair
+1
2
L'ensemble constitu de squences longueur maximale
privilgies et la somme modulo 2 de ces squences forment
l'ensemble de squences de Gold.

Les codes de Walsh-Hadamard

Ces codes constituent les lignes des matrices


de Walsh-Hadamard et qui sont definis par :

W1=[0]
On ne considre que les matrices carres
dune dimension L multiple de 2.

WL/2 complment de WL/2 par rapport 1

WL / 2 WL / 2
WL =

W
W
L/2
L/2

Les codes de Walsh-Hadamard dordre 4


c1 0
c 0
W4 = 2 =
c3 0

c4 0

0 0 0
1 0 1
0 1 1

1 1 0

Les codes c1, c2, c3 et c4 sont orthogonaux


deux deux
c1*c2=(-1)x(-1)+(-1)x1+(-1)x(-1)+(-1)x1=0
c1*c3=(-1)x(-1)+(-1)x(-1)+(-1)x1+(-1)x1=0
c2*c3=(-1)x(-1)+1x(-1)+(-1)x1+1x1=0
c3*c4=(-1)x(-1)+(-1)x1+1x1+1x(-1)=0

L'IS95 et les systmes 2 G


amricains

IS 95

Issue de l'organisme amricain TIA (Tlcommunications


Industry Association), la norme
IS95 a t propose par la socit Qualcomm pour fonctionner
sur deux bandes de frquences : 800 MHz. (Band Class 0) et 1
900 MHz (Band Class 1 - PCS). Sur la premire (Band Class 0).
l'IS95 doit cohabiter avec le systme analogique AMPS
(Advanced Mobile Phone Service), tous deux se partageant une
largeur de bande de 25 MHz.

L'IS95 fonctionne en squence directe c'est--dire sans


changement de porteuse pour un terminal dans le cours d'une
communication, sauf en cas de handoff et occupe une largeur
de bande de 1.25 MHz par porteuse et par sens de
communication : station de base vers terminal et terminal vers
station de base.

L'interface radio

La mthode d'accs CDMA institue dans l'interface radio de


l'IS95 deux tapes de modulation avant l'envoi de
l'information sur le canal.
Une premire modulation talement avec un code pseudo
alatoire et une deuxime modulation binaire de phase

Donnes

Etalement

Chips

Modulation de phase

Signal RF

Sens montant

Dans le sens montant, le circuit du canal physique se compose de deux


parties principales : le code du canal et l'information porte par ce
canal. Pour chaque canal physique, l'IS95 gnre une squence
alatoire, appele long mask, qui permet de moduler l'information utile.
C'est cette modulation, ou talement, qui multiplexe les utilisateurs du
systme selon la mthode CDMA.
Le gnrateur des squences est constitu d'un registre dcalage de
42 cases. La priode de ce gnrateur est donc gale 242 - 1. Cette
priode est relativement longue au regard d'un dbit de squences
1.228 8 Mchip/s. La dure qui spare deux codes identiques est de :
(242-1)/1.2288Mchip/s = 41.1 jours

Sens montant

La figure 7.3 retrace les tapes de modulation de la voie montante. La partie


intrieure reprsente le traitement de l'information de l'utilisateur. L'IS95 rend
accessibles quatre sortes de dbits : 1 200, 2 400, 4 800 et 9 600 bit/s.
Ces dbits bruts doivent tre protgs lors de leur transmission dans le canal.
Cette protection est assure par un code convolutionnel de taux 1/3 et de
longueur 9. Ces multiples dbits reoivent un traitement identique, qui les
calibre 9 600 bit/s.
Le systme est alors amen rguler le trafic selon une valeur unique pour le
remplissage des trames de l'interface radio. Ces trames sont maintenues a une
valeur de 20 ms. Pour les dbits faibles, la couche physique procde une
rptition de l'information.
Ainsi, l'information 1 200 bit/s est rpte huit fois. tandis que celles a 2 400 et
4 800 bit/s le sont respectivement quatre et deux fois.

Gnrateur Long Mask

Informations
dbit variable

Code
convolutionnel

Rptition

Entrelacement

Code Walsh

Rptition des symboles, ramenant tous les dbits 9 600 bit/s,


et du codage convolutionnel. multipliant cette valeur par 3. on
obtient un dfilement de l'information une vitesse de 28.8 Kbit/s
(9 600 x 3).
L'ne opration supplmentaire s'exerce sur la voie montante,
dcoulant de l'intervention d'une matrice Walsh-Hadamard de
dimension 64. Cette matrice permet de renforcer la protection de
l'information contre les erreurs. Elle est quivalente
l'application d'un code correcteur C(64. 6). L'information est
regroupe en blocs de 6 bits. chaque bloc tant cod sur 64 bits.
ce qui amplifie le dbit sortant. Ce dernier atteint la valeur de
307.2 Kbit/s.
L'talement survient en tant que phase ultime de la modulation
binaire. Chaque bit est tal par 4 chips grce aux squences
alatoires de la voie montante. Un flux de 1.228 8 MChip/s est
envoy vers le modulateur de phase QPSK pour une
transmission vers la station de base par l'interface Radio.

Oprations de modulation voie montante .


Opration

1200 bits/s

2 400 bits/s

4 800 bits/s

9 600 bits/s

Rptition

Dbit aprs codage (1/3)

28.8 Kbit/s

28.8 Kbit/s

28.8 Kbit/s

28.8 Kbit/s

Codage Walsh

307.2 kbit/s

307.2 kbit/s

307.2 kbit/s

307.2 kbit/s

1.2288Mchip/s

1.2288Mchip/s

1.2288 Mchip/s

1.2288Mchip/s

Squence dtalement

Dbit Chip

Sens descendant

La technique de transmission sur la voie descendante est


diffrente de la prcdente, ce qui dmarque l'IS95 du GSM,
o le duplex ne s'effectue que d'une seule faon.

Oprations de modulation voie descendante .

Opration

1200 bits/s

2 400 bits/s

4 800 bits/s

9 600 bits/s

Rptition

19.2 Kbit/s

19.2 Kbit/s

19.2 Kbit/s

19.2 Kbit/s

64

64

64

64

1.2288 Mchip/s

1.2288
Mchip/s

1.2288
Mchip/s

1.2288 Mchip/s

Dbit aprs codage (1/2)

Squence dtalement

Dbit Chip

Rcepteurs CDMA

Rcepteur RAKE

Capacit : Dfinition

Capacit : Elments de dimensionnement

Capacit UL

Capacit UL

Capacit UL

Capacit UL

Capacit DL

Capacit DL

Capacit DL

Capacit DL

Respiration des cellules

Comparaison UL/DL

Gestion de ressources

Gestion de ressources

Standardisation de
lIMT2000 & lUMTS

Quest-ce que lIMT-2000?

Objectifs de lIMT-2000

Famille de standards 3G

Bandes de frquence dfinies pour lIMT-2000

UTRA : UMTS Terrestrial Radio Access

3rd Generation Partnership Project

Architecture fonctionnelle

Applications potentielles UMTS

Applications et classes de trafic

Services support

Oprateur rseau vs fournisseur de service

Vous aimerez peut-être aussi